I am wondering if it is possible to enter a User-Expression in the system fan Static pressure box that would reset system static pressure. For an example based on time of day for reset during unoccupied hours by either changing curves or changing the system static. I am thinking along the lines of Fortran code.. if > then ... logic. Is this possible? Has anyone done it?

I am very familiar with the static reset curves by Hydeman and Stein published in the in the EDR and am looking for more options.
